
HR Data Management Specialist
14 hours ago
As a key member of our global team, you will play a vital role in ensuring the accuracy, integrity, and usability of employee data and HR systems—primarily Workday. Your primary responsibility will be to ensure the consistency, timeliness, and accuracy of employee data across the entire employee lifecycle.
You will be an individual contributor role within the global HRIS team, responsible for delivering high-quality, compliant support that aligns with global service level agreements. This includes handling employee data transactions and managing tickets from multiple geographies, as well as contributing to system testing, process improvement initiatives, and cross-functional coordination to optimize tools and workflows that support HR operations.
Due to access to confidential and sensitive employee information, the role requires a high level of discretion, professionalism, and adherence to data privacy standards—any mishandling or breach may lead to disciplinary consequences.
Required Skills and QualificationsTo succeed in this role, you should have:
- 1–2 years of experience in HRIS support, employee data management, or HR operations, preferably in a Shared Services or multi-geo setup.
- Working knowledge of Workday or similar HRIS platforms.
- Strong attention to detail, with a commitment to data accuracy and compliance.
- Ability to manage case queues and meet deadlines in a high-volume, service-driven environment.
- Good written and verbal communication skills; comfortable responding to stakeholders across channels.
- Demonstrated ability to handle confidential information with discretion.

What You Will AchieveAs an HRIS Specialist, your responsibilities will include:
- Deliver day-to-day support for employee data transactions from pre-employment through offboarding, ensuring accuracy and compliance in Workday and other HR systems.
- Maintain and protect confidential employee data with a high degree of discretion and responsibility.
- Provide global production support by researching and resolving HCM process and data issues, collaborating closely with the HR Operations team and other key stakeholders.
- Respond to tickets, emails, and chats from internal users as needed, escalating to the HRIS Supervisor for complex or sensitive cases.
- Monitor Workday inbox and ensure timely execution of assigned tasks, keeping data clean and audit-ready.
